Heatstroke cases rise to 170 in state: Health dept

The rising mercury levels throughout the state contributed to the growing number of heatstroke cases. Officials from the health department said they established necessary facilities across the state to provide treatment for affected patients.
"Necessary measures have been implemented across the state for preventing heatstroke cases, treatment, and management," said Dr Narrottam Sharma, state nodal officer (climate change), health department.
The department reserved beds for heatstroke cases in hospitals for immediate treatment.
He said the department is in touch with the meteorological department for weather-related alerts. The department is issuing weather-related alerts to districts in the morning, asking them to take necessary action according to the heat-related alert sent by it.
The department made arrangements for the initial management of heatstroke in govt ambulances.
